Browser FX is a Chrome extension that adds real-time audio effects to the sound coming from a browser tab. It is designed for websites that play audio or video, letting you shape playback without leaving the browser.
The extension combines a 22-effect library, per-tab settings, and up to four effects in series. It also supports MIDI control and an audio-reactive visualizer, so users can adjust sound with either the popup interface or external hardware while audio is playing.
According to the listing, all processing happens locally in the browser using the Web Audio API, and no account is required. That makes it a fit for people who want direct control over tab audio without a separate sign-in flow or external audio service.
Processes audio from a website tab in real time, so you can adjust sound while media is playing instead of exporting or reloading content.
Offers 22 effects, including reverb, filters, EQ, bitcrusher, delay, chorus, flanger, tremolo, pitch shifting, compressor, DJ EQ, tape stop, and lo-fi tape.
Allows up to 4 effects to be stacked in series, with drag-to-reorder controls and per-effect bypass so you can build a custom chain.
Supports one-click MIDI learn for external controllers, with knobs mapped to parameters and pads or buttons mapped to effect on/off.
Keeps separate settings per tab and saves them automatically, which helps when you want different processing for different sites or sessions.
Includes an audio-reactive cymatic visualizer and full stereo processing, alongside on-screen knobs for live adjustment.

It is a Chrome extension for processing audio from a tab in real time. The page says you click the icon, choose or stack effects, and then control them from the popup or a MIDI controller.
Yes. The product page says settings are saved per tab, so different tabs can keep different effect chains.
The page says Browser FX can map any MIDI controller with one-click MIDI learn, and that knobs control parameters while pads and buttons toggle effects.
The listed workflow is real-time processing in the browser. The page also says all processing happens locally using the Web Audio API and that no account is required.
The source page does not list a paid plan or in-app purchase details, so the pricing model is not clear from the available evidence.
